Hong Kong stocks fall at open ahead of GDP figures
HONG KONG, July 31, 2019 (BSS/AFP) – Hong Kong stocks fell sharply at the
open Wednesday ahead of the release of quarterly growth figures in the
financial hub and with US-China trade talks under way in Shanghai.
The Hang Seng Index was down 1.02 percent, or 286.09 points, at 28,860.41.
The benchmark Shanghai Composite Index fell 0.27 percent, or 7.94 points,
at 2944.40.
The Shenzhen Composite Index, which tracks stocks on China’s second
exchange, lost 0.22 percent, or 3.52 points, to open at 1578.55.
